ZappoMan
|
275fff4609
|
more CR feedback
|
2017-10-24 14:02:47 -07:00 |
|
ZappoMan
|
a1885926b5
|
some cleanup
|
2017-10-24 11:46:42 -07:00 |
|
ZappoMan
|
1128a98e88
|
implement callEntityClientMethod
|
2017-10-24 11:15:57 -07:00 |
|
ZappoMan
|
a7e21d7e76
|
add remotelyCallable and remoteCallerID to provide additional security to Entities.callEntityServerMethod()
|
2017-10-22 14:30:58 -07:00 |
|
ZappoMan
|
fb7f6df694
|
CR feedback
|
2017-10-22 11:40:41 -07:00 |
|
ZappoMan
|
934c9479af
|
implement support for Entities.callEntityServerMethod()
|
2017-10-21 20:27:35 -07:00 |
|
Clément Brisset
|
725dc1851e
|
Merge pull request #11412 from mnafees/21495
CR for Job #21495 - Add limit to file size imported into asset server
|
2017-10-13 13:45:42 -07:00 |
|
Stephen Birarda
|
8a331e29a2
|
Merge pull request #11455 from utkarshgautamnyu/feat/JS-Baker
Feat/JS-Baker
|
2017-10-12 16:16:02 -05:00 |
|
Mohammed Nafees
|
52e29c07cc
|
Fix warning resulting in build error
|
2017-10-11 19:59:04 -04:00 |
|
Mohammed Nafees
|
19b00e1364
|
Add option to limit assets filesize in settings
|
2017-10-11 19:59:04 -04:00 |
|
Seth Alves
|
4d2f16efc3
|
allow project to be built with clang on Linux
|
2017-10-08 18:01:41 -07:00 |
|
Ryan Huffman
|
a6d148475b
|
Add removal of temporary baked files in AssetServer
|
2017-10-05 09:08:42 -07:00 |
|
Andrew Meadows
|
ad9a239b45
|
remove unused cruft
|
2017-09-29 11:34:36 -07:00 |
|
Andrew Meadows
|
86cbea73c8
|
less magic
|
2017-09-29 11:34:36 -07:00 |
|
Andrew Meadows
|
01304de8c2
|
indent switch statement, use const ref
|
2017-09-29 11:34:36 -07:00 |
|
Andrew Meadows
|
5dcd6bc496
|
namechange: apparentAngle --> angularDiameter
|
2017-09-29 11:34:35 -07:00 |
|
Andrew Meadows
|
1c30f7424e
|
remove cruft and add comments
|
2017-09-29 11:34:35 -07:00 |
|
SamGondelman
|
3ae41b9b75
|
cleanup client and stats string
|
2017-09-29 11:34:35 -07:00 |
|
SamGondelman
|
f7af581c71
|
track traversal time, rename entity server stat
|
2017-09-29 11:34:35 -07:00 |
|
Andrew Meadows
|
a56c076149
|
fix bad resolution during rebase
|
2017-09-29 11:34:35 -07:00 |
|
Andrew Meadows
|
99265a5758
|
remove extra parens
|
2017-09-29 11:34:35 -07:00 |
|
Andrew Meadows
|
25d250898b
|
remove old debug info
|
2017-09-29 11:34:35 -07:00 |
|
Andrew Meadows
|
49e11d2173
|
fix Differential scan logic for LOD culling
|
2017-09-29 11:34:35 -07:00 |
|
SamGondelman
|
f2de03bc38
|
small fixes and LOD cull children instead of parent
|
2017-09-29 11:34:35 -07:00 |
|
Andrew Meadows
|
624d0c12a2
|
minor cleanup
|
2017-09-29 11:34:35 -07:00 |
|
SamGondelman
|
cbd20f89dd
|
separate elementBag logic from EntityTreeSendThread
|
2017-09-29 11:34:35 -07:00 |
|
SamGondelman
|
bf1065b56e
|
track encode stats
|
2017-09-29 11:34:35 -07:00 |
|
Andrew Meadows
|
a0f95ca5bd
|
swap order of evaluation for minor theoretical speedup
|
2017-09-29 11:34:35 -07:00 |
|
Andrew Meadows
|
3433c5c414
|
remove redundant boolean logic
|
2017-09-29 11:34:35 -07:00 |
|
SamGondelman
|
defed80be7
|
edited entities are not repeatedly sent if out of view, handles cases where usesViewFrustum changes
|
2017-09-29 11:34:34 -07:00 |
|
SamGondelman
|
7938e301e7
|
full scene traversal and json filters
|
2017-09-29 11:34:34 -07:00 |
|
SamGondelman
|
0ad5f47bfd
|
trying to fix entity editing bugs, needs testing
|
2017-09-29 11:34:34 -07:00 |
|
SamGondelman
|
6c066605cd
|
add state to entity tree send thread
|
2017-09-29 11:34:34 -07:00 |
|
Andrew Meadows
|
6edba6d545
|
erase in _entitiesInQueue when pop _sendQueue
|
2017-09-29 11:34:34 -07:00 |
|
Andrew Meadows
|
535d84abc7
|
cleanup and speed up repeat traversals
|
2017-09-29 11:34:34 -07:00 |
|
Andrew Meadows
|
b788273f47
|
fix repeat First traversals mid-First-traversal
|
2017-09-29 11:34:34 -07:00 |
|
Andrew Meadows
|
d54fa205fb
|
namechange entitiesToSend --> entitiesInQueue
|
2017-09-29 11:34:34 -07:00 |
|
SamGondelman
|
b85a5507e0
|
time budget and raw pointer key for entitiesToSend
|
2017-09-29 11:34:34 -07:00 |
|
Andrew Meadows
|
b6818c4369
|
first-pass sending entities from _sendQueue
|
2017-09-29 11:34:34 -07:00 |
|
Andrew Meadows
|
1562fb153e
|
cherrypick traverseTreeAndBuildNextPacketPayload()
|
2017-09-29 11:34:34 -07:00 |
|
Sam Gondelman
|
a32cc7f555
|
typo
|
2017-09-29 11:34:34 -07:00 |
|
SamGondelman
|
971f1e7924
|
put lodLevelOffset back
|
2017-09-29 11:34:34 -07:00 |
|
SamGondelman
|
1930c8f215
|
only resort if view changed
|
2017-09-29 11:34:34 -07:00 |
|
SamGondelman
|
18f88a5a64
|
keep track of readded entities in a set to avoid rechecking them, compute priority early
|
2017-09-29 11:34:34 -07:00 |
|
SamGondelman
|
9fb7eb4ba6
|
resort _sendQueue when previous view didn't finish
|
2017-09-29 11:34:34 -07:00 |
|
Andrew Meadows
|
4f50b5755f
|
remove crufty argument
|
2017-09-29 11:34:34 -07:00 |
|
SamGondelman
|
bb5368eb55
|
use correct rootSizeScale
|
2017-09-29 11:34:33 -07:00 |
|
SamGondelman
|
b0f30acce2
|
use cube instead of entityBounds
|
2017-09-29 11:34:33 -07:00 |
|
SamGondelman
|
4c8f683479
|
entity too small checks
|
2017-09-29 11:34:33 -07:00 |
|
Andrew Meadows
|
e114fa1b82
|
fix debug traversal repeat logic
|
2017-09-29 11:34:33 -07:00 |
|